Choose Push Security if your primary anxiety is browser-driven attacks (AiTM, ClickFix, AI tool data leakage) and you need real-time control across unmanaged identities and SaaS. Choose Antigen if your focus is continuous, automated penetration testing of your production attack surface with actionable, developer-friendly findings. They solve different problems—one protects the browser endpoint, the other probes your cloud infrastructure.

Who should pick which

  • Security team worried about browser-based phishing and AI data leakage
    Pick: Push Security

    Push Security directly detects and blocks AiTM, ClickFix, and OAuth attacks, plus controls AI tool data flows—features Antigen doesn't address.

  • DevOps team needing continuous, automated pentesting of production infrastructure
    Pick: Antigen

    Antigen's nightly scans of endpoints, SAST integration, and developer-friendly findings match DevOps workflows better than Push's browser focus.

  • Compliance officer requiring auditable vulnerability evidence and monthly human validation
    Pick: Antigen

    Antigen provides reproduction steps, exploitability scoring, and monthly red team reports—ideal for compliance audits.

  • Identity team hardening MFA/SSO adoption and detecting shadow SaaS
    Pick: Push Security

    Push Security's in-browser MFA guardrails and ghost login detection directly support identity security goals.

  • Security leader seeking zero-cost starting point for browser security
    Pick: Push Security

    Push Security's freemium model allows trialing core browser protection without initial investment.

Do Push Security and Antigen overlap in functionality?

Minimally. Push focuses on browser-based attacks and AI data control; Antigen focuses on infrastructure and application pen testing. They are complementary.

Which tool is better for protecting against AI-powered phishing?

Push Security, as it specifically detects AiTM, ClickFix, and ConsentFix attacks—common in AI-driven phishing campaigns.

Does Antigen scan the same attack surface as Push?

No. Antigen scans your production infrastructure (cloud services, endpoints, APIs) for vulnerabilities. Push monitors browser telemetry on endpoints to detect threats in real time.

Can I use Push Security without deploying an enterprise browser?

Yes. Push works as a browser extension or agent on existing browsers (Chrome, Edge, etc.).

Does Antigen require any changes to my development workflow?

It integrates via GitHub Action for SAST checks in pull requests, fitting into existing CI/CD pipelines.

Which tool offers a free tier?

Push Security has a freemium model with a free tier. Antigen does not—pricing is custom via sales.

Can Antigen detect OAuth attacks?

No, that's outside its scope. Push Security detects malicious OAuth integrations and identity-based attacks.
